Personnel reshuffle at BASF in Ludwigshafen
On 1 July 2013, Bernhard Nick will take over as head of Strategic Planning & Controlling at German chemical giant BASF (Ludwigshafen; www.basf.com). He currently serves as president of the group’s Verbund Site Management Europe division. Nick will succeed Walter Gramlich, who is set to retire in June this year.

Nick’s current post, which includes the management of BASF’s Ludwigshafen site, will be filled by Friedrich Seitz on 1 June 2013. The latter’s current position as head of the group’s Process Research & Chemical Engineering division will in turn be assumed by Peter Schuhmacher on 1 May 2012. Schuhmacher currently acts as senior vice president Strategic Planning.
